    Hello renes It is my belief that the "export" (to North America) version of the Freudenstadt 11 is the SABA model 200 (1961-62). This model, as well as the export versions of the Meersburg 11 and Freiburg 11, was equipped with a stereo decoder specially designed for SABA by the "Fisher" Corporation (USA) Three tubes (1 x ECF80 2 x ECC83) (This is from my poor memory..Please correct me if I am wrong....)     Zitat: „Peter J posteteAnd here's my first question - what function do have those double gears connected with some kind of spring, and how should they be put together? For the maksimum tension of that spring or around the middle?“ Hello Peter. The dual gear-set with spring tension is to remove "backlash" or loose fit in the mechanical tuning control. This is a common design to many tuning systems of many radios, whether manual tuning (see in also TO variable capacitors)- or models with motorized…

    Zitat: „dl2jas postete 1N4148 in series with with a lamp 0,2A? Dangerous! Use something like 1N4004, a rectifier diode. The 1N4148 is a small signal diode, max. 100 mA. You are right, the 1N4148 is oririginally a high speed diode, suitable for (old) AM detectors and HF-mixers. I have some from ITT, not the (chinese) plagiates you buy today as "versatile diode".
